Can You Really Save Money by Moving Without Movers?

Many individuals question whether relocating without professional movers truly saves money. While it's tempting to assume that DIY moving signals significant cost savings, the truth can be more subtle. Factors such as distance, amount of belongings, and accessibility of your current and new locations all play a role in determining if a DIY move is truly budget-friendly.

  • Distance: If you're moving long distances, the costs of renting a truck, fuel, and potential lodging can quickly accumulate, possibly exceeding the savings of hiring movers.
  • Items: A large quantity of belongings often requires professional packing and loading assistance. Attempting to manage this yourself can be arduous and possibly result in damage.
  • Access/Obstacles: Difficult access to your current or new home, such as narrow streets or stairs, can hinder a DIY move and potentially increase the risk of harm.

Ultimately, meticulously assessing your specific factors is crucial to determine if a DIY move truly offers cost savings.
